Kapuskasing, Ontario vs Riga Climate & Distance Between

Latvia flag
  • The distance between Kapuskasing, Ontario, Canada and Riga, Latvia is approximately 6,404 km or 3,980 mi.
  • To reach Kapuskasing, Ontario in this distance one would set out from Riga bearing 312.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kapuskasing, Ontario bearing 218.3° or SW .
  •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Kapuskasing, Ontario is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Riga is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 5.7 °C (10.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.9 °C (25°F) more in Kapuskasing, Ontario.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 225.1 mm (8.9 in) more which is equivalent to 225.1 l/m² (5.52 US gal/ft²) or 2,251,000 l/ha (240,647 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
  • There are 174 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Kapuskasing, Ontario. In whichever way circa 0h 28' less per day or about 1 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.5° higher in Kapuskasing, Ontario than in Riga.
  • Relative humidity levels are 11.5%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 7.8°C (14°F) lower.
